Paper Title: wireless power theft detection using zigbee technology

Abstract: Electricity has become the priority for every organization and individual due to the emerging developments Power theft is one of the major issues of electricity transmission and distribution. It is prominent in developing countries and pilots to an annual losses of around INR 3000 crores in India. It is estimated that power theft accounts to 1.5% of gross domestic production (GDP) which is significant and cannot be negligible. Power theft prevention is a system used to perceives and prevent illegal load tappings on distribution lines. Many schemes are available for the same. A wireless ZigBee module is employed for this purpose. An automatic control unit is used to inject frequency distribution in L.V lines, after disconnecting the legal consumer’s loads once power theft is detected. A simple design for single phase distribution system is proposed for analysis and same can be implemented for three phase system by adding relevant features.
